Puerto Rico

Caribbean island, visited by Columbus in 1493. The first Spanish settlement was made by Ponce de Leon in 1508, but the island remained under-developed. A plantation economy only grew after 1830. It came und `er American rule in 1898. Puerto Ricans were given US citizenship and self-government in 1917 but have yet to decide to accept full statehood.
